Au bistro, the most trendy of vintage cafés in Marché St Honoré






In the era of sushi-bars and iPads, finance whiz kids and trend setters come to steal a few moments amongst the frenzy of globalization. The « garçon de café » waiter, writes up the daily specials with a chalk on the blackboard:pot au feu, shepherds pie, crème brûlée… In this formica decor, there is a film-like quality that brings to mind scenes directed by Michel Audiard !


We like: « That’s Paris » in a café, the real thing where the lady-owner serves pretty boys in Weston shoes and twigs deck out with labels from head to foot, stop by « in old-fashioned style» for a cup of coffee or to bite into a ham and cheese sandwich while reading the Figaro or Vogue and sipping a glass of Saint Nicolas de Bourgueil.

Count 15-20 €
